I have downloaded Oldboys v6.525 update as this was the last time i was getting a hands-free connection. How do you install it, do you remove the 5 folders with the same name as the ones in Oldboys update and then install Oldboys files to replace them(at the root of my TTGo710).
Also from the 5 folders in the download i only have 4 of them, I dont have the system folder but i have the other 4, do you think this could cause my hands-free not to work. I have backed-up so at least i can go back to that if needed. _________________ NEW Tomtom GO 500 (hope it is good)

V7.xxx software doesn't use the system File. All previous versions did.
The 5 Files in the download are pasted in to the Root of the Unit using Explorer. Just reply Yes when asked if you want to Overwrite.
It will re-flash the ROM before re-booting. _________________ Richard
